**********************************************************************************************Normal Hall of Fame rules apply. If you are unsure of the rules, get with me or post the question in this thread.

The three ineligible films will be Wall E, Ratatouille, and Beauty and the Beast as those three have already won specialty Hall of Fames.

Short films won't be eligible here. We are going for feature length only.

No.

The rules are that each participant nominates one film, then all participants watch and review every nominated film, then send a ballot to the host with all nominated films ranked in order of best to worst. You don't get to pick and choose which films you watch.
